简易Java版OA系统教程与源代码解析

版权申诉
0 下载量 36 浏览量 更新于2024-10-26 收藏 210KB RAR 举报
资源摘要信息:"OA系统开发文档" 知识点: 1. OA系统概念:OA系统,即办公自动化系统(Office Automation System),是一种用于提高工作效率、优化业务流程、实现办公自动化的软件系统。它包括文档管理、工作流程、邮件系统、会议管理、项目管理等功能模块。 2. Java语言基础:Java是一种广泛使用的编程语言,具有跨平台、面向对象、多线程、安全性高等特点。Java语言的基础包括语法、数据类型、控制流程、面向对象的概念等。 3. 系统开发:系统开发是一个包含需求分析、设计、编码、测试、维护等多个阶段的过程。在这个过程中,开发人员需要根据需求设计系统架构,编写代码,进行测试,最后部署上线。 4. 简单OA系统开发:简单OA系统通常包括用户登录、信息查看、工作流程处理等基础功能。在这个过程中,开发人员需要熟悉Java语言,以及数据库、网络编程等知识。 5. 代码阅读与理解:阅读和理解别人的代码是一项非常重要的技能。通过阅读别人的代码,可以学习到别人的设计思想和编程技巧,同时也能提高自己的编程能力。 6. 项目实践:实践是提高编程技能的最佳方式。通过实际项目的开发,可以将理论知识应用到实践中,提高自己的实战能力。 7. 文档编写:文档编写是项目开发中非常重要的一部分。通过编写文档,可以详细记录项目的开发过程,方便项目维护和后续开发。 8. 简单易懂的代码:简单易懂的代码可以降低项目的维护成本,提高开发效率。在开发过程中,应该尽量编写简单易懂的代码。 9. 项目反馈与建议:项目反馈与建议是项目开发中不可或缺的一部分。通过收集用户的反馈,可以不断优化和改进项目,提供更好的用户体验。 10. 文件压缩与解压缩:文件压缩与解压缩是一种常用的数据存储和传输方式。通过压缩文件,可以节省存储空间,加快数据传输速度。